Many of the forest scenes were filmed at the Fahrtechnikakademie Kallinchen near Berlin. This place is a former military testing area of the German Democratic Republic.
The tattoo on Noah's back, and in a picture in the 1986 version of the local hospital, is of The Emerald Tablet, an ancient text, part of what is known as "Hermetica", a collection of occultist 2nd Century Greco-Egyptian "wisdom texts". It describes, among other things, alchemy experiments, transmutation, and the creation of the universe. More importantly, it discusses the idea that both large and small actions are all connected and influence each other, which is a central theme of the series. Also, conspiracy theorists claim, since according to some people, the text is much older than the language it contains, that it might be from somewhere unknown, some claim aliens, some claim time-travel.
First German series produced by Netflix.
Originally the show runners Baran Bo Odar and Jantje Friese were asked by Netflix to create a series from their movie Who Am I (2014). They were not interested and proposed to create something new: They already had plans for a series inspired by The Missing (2014) and a time travel movie and merged both ideas to finally pitch DARK.
The symbol on the cover of H.G. Tannhaus' book is the Penrose Triangle; an "impossible object" optical illusion created by psychiatrist Dr. Lionel Penrose and his son, mathematician and Nobel laureate Sir Roger Penrose. Roger Penrose authored one of several interpretations of quantum mechanics, which Tannhaus lectures the audience on in season 3.
